CREDITON Parish Church Music Endowment Fund was delighted to see huge public support for its Isca Voices concert on Saturday, April 2.

We had only put out 30 tea cups on the worktop in the Boniface Centre and in the end were a bit concerned that we wouldn’t have enough cake to feed the large crowd that turned up.

There had only been 33 at the last concert in 2019 so it was a relief to see the church filling up.

Ever the optimist, I had in fact printed off 80 tickets, but only 50 programmes so we didn’t overdo our outgoings and couples were able to share.  A nice problem to have!  Perhaps my previous editorial in the “Crediton Courier” and Crediton Parish Magazine had paid dividends. A total of 75 tickets were sold and together with some very generous donations meant we raised just over £450, which is very satisfying.  Thank you for your support.

The concert was well received and we enjoyed a lovely mixture of well-known classics and some lighter renditions including “Imagine” by John Lennon, also a classic nowadays, and some lively Jazz numbers arranged and conducted by Stephen Tanner.

The former Girl Choristers from Exeter Cathedral acquitted themselves very professionally and it was a joy to hear such fresh voices filling the church again in concert after three years’ drought.
